commit:     1a8dbc2b7db90113d9fca318cf8313a4c24c9f7e
Author:     Michael Weber <xmw <AT> gentoo <DOT> org>
AuthorDate: Mon Dec 18 15:08:27 2017 +0000
Commit:     Michael Weber <xmw <AT> gentoo <DOT> org>
CommitDate: Mon Dec 18 15:08:27 2017 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=1a8dbc2b

dev-libs/libnsfb: Version bump.

Bug: https://bugs.gentoo.org/636224
Package-Manager: Portage-2.3.19, Repoman-2.3.6

 dev-libs/libnsfb/Manifest             |  2 ++
 dev-libs/libnsfb/libnsfb-0.1.6.ebuild | 39 +++++++++++++++++++++++++++++++++++
 2 files changed, 41 insertions(+)

diff --git a/dev-libs/libnsfb/Manifest b/dev-libs/libnsfb/Manifest
index 1f7beade0be..34ae34e7c7e 100644
--- a/dev-libs/libnsfb/Manifest
+++ b/dev-libs/libnsfb/Manifest
@@ -1,2 +1,4 @@
 DIST libnsfb-0.1.5-src.tar.gz 82897 BLAKE2B 
cc1287d8ac9d82f2286c7e4a0046e6bd05e994e3db50480c76f6bbf2fe8c1eae8593c53a0d59618b189979e196b7e23f4b55a7e5d311926b15c44ce623d5299b
 SHA512 
7e1ff83552beb10fa44a05e34315502514c1eb9f160ec53f367d74718915400ac6630748704ffc2d4ea8633f74e0c446931042b6cbb7d9a2828a3cc565c872d4
+DIST libnsfb-0.1.6-src.tar.gz 83510 BLAKE2B 
4d4c5cea7ae0f9a799cbf515f6ccad6bb24008f622871c0f4498bd2f292955d5c1c70fdff406839cc9173b3cdf17c7552563841eec5e1849624c4b25196fc36c
 SHA512 
ed22b593e6475ee023818b8fe8109922b5714624137f71193edbd9d12c73003d5e161aba3cc86aed6c03dee3e247f251b3dc4d34db008d4cbfcae89331f34ee3
 DIST netsurf-buildsystem-1.4.tar.gz 38067 BLAKE2B 
cd09909e0565a7e63f16082c653f7dbf8de3e6b4d61aadd213bcd884a7cd3d10d8e22859322ffbe71a7d99823b3789c6e2454ea50cbe75578dc7d6eab324d0f5
 SHA512 
2c804ad7bef70c987e1d393ee4041bffc9797893b4fd513c90a665027205a1f7eee0a7d86ddaf833a6ee18346d6fe69587190c4e6722afc4ed18ce87783c35fc
+DIST netsurf-buildsystem-1.6.tar.gz 38204 BLAKE2B 
58ac4aa2676c019a69b53f5115c82b522aa7db7b2a039a36f227b06b1d031ddc1eed463b09bfd13aeabddc421b2de396b58f2f8f131c261d5633fcd7a85272de
 SHA512 
65ecafb54fc79107cfdb0fbea6acd4cad1fc9f338dde2ed9a48de066e245b7804a16337769c7602c7ab96b0d7544970f533d8c4615913c09b5a9ca4b9386fb28

diff --git a/dev-libs/libnsfb/libnsfb-0.1.6.ebuild 
b/dev-libs/libnsfb/libnsfb-0.1.6.ebuild
new file mode 100644
index 00000000000..bd2d58faebd
--- /dev/null
+++ b/dev-libs/libnsfb/libnsfb-0.1.6.ebuild
@@ -0,0 +1,39 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=5
+
+NETSURF_BUILDSYSTEM=buildsystem-1.6
+inherit netsurf
+
+DESCRIPTION="framebuffer abstraction library, written in C"
+HOMEPAGE="http://www.netsurf-browser.org/projects/libnsfb/";
+
+LICENSE="MIT"
+SLOT="0/${PV}"
+KEYWORDS="~amd64 ~arm ~ppc"
+IUSE="sdl test vnc wayland xcb"
+
+RDEPEND="sdl? ( >=media-libs/libsdl-1.2.15-r4[static-libs?,${MULTILIB_USEDEP}] 
)
+       vnc? ( 
>=net-libs/libvncserver-0.9.9-r2[static-libs?,${MULTILIB_USEDEP}] )
+       wayland? ( >=dev-libs/wayland-1.0.6[static-libs?,${MULTILIB_USEDEP}] )
+       xcb? ( >=x11-libs/libxcb-1.9.1[static-libs?,${MULTILIB_USEDEP}]
+               >=x11-libs/xcb-util-0.3.9-r1[static-libs?,${MULTILIB_USEDEP}]
+               
>=x11-libs/xcb-util-image-0.3.9-r1[static-libs?,${MULTILIB_USEDEP}]
+               
>=x11-libs/xcb-util-keysyms-0.3.9-r1[static-libs?,${MULTILIB_USEDEP}] )"
+DEPEND="${RDEPEND}"
+
+PATCHES=( "${FILESDIR}"/${PN}-0.1.0-autodetect.patch )
+
+DOCS=( usage )
+
+src_configure() {
+       netsurf_src_configure
+
+       netsurf_makeconf+=(
+               WITH_VNC=$(usex vnc)
+               WITH_SDL=$(usex sdl)
+               WITH_XCB=$(usex xcb)
+               WITH_WLD=$(usex wayland)
+       )
+}

Reply via email to